Buying a home in Borger Buitengebied, Borger.
In Borger Buitengebied you're buying space: large plots with detached homes, plenty of greenery, quiet roads. You're not in a village proper, but somewhere in between, which is exactly what many people want when they have kids or value peace. The area grows slowly, so you won't wake up to sudden development. Shops and schools are in Borger itself, just a few minutes' drive away.

Best things and drawbacks to living in Borger Buitengebied
Pros:
- Plenty of space around your home: large plots, privacy, and neighbors are not on top of each other
- Low house prices compared to urban areas; you get a lot of square meters for your money
- Quiet and green: you live among fields, forests, and farmland; minimal traffic
- Close to the Hunebedcentrum and prehistoric megaliths; distinctive local character
Cons:
- Car is essential: no train station in Borger itself, bus connections are limited and infrequent
- Limited amenities: no supermarket or pharmacy in the immediate area; everything is in Borger village or further away
- Little social life: no nightlife, few young people, isolation can be real
- Poor internet connection in many parts of the countryside; fiber-optic is not available everywhere

What does Borger Buitengebied offer?
Borger puts you among farmland and open countryside, where homes typically come with more space than you'd find in the city. It's a place where neighbors know each other, and you're ten minutes from proper nature. The village center has what you need day-to-day, and Groningen is close if you want more. Many houses here are converted farmsteads or 1970s builds with real potential, so there's room to shape something of your own.

Housing market Borger Buitengebied
In Borger, the real estate market shows notable changes. Last quarter, 16 homes sold, compared to 14 this quarter. The average transaction price went from 439,000 euros last quarter to 490,000 euros this quarter. The average transaction price per square meter rose from 3,422 euros to 3,492 euros. The average list price increased from 418,000 euros last quarter to 457,000 euros this quarter. Additionally, the average WOZ-value this year is higher than last year, reflecting a positive trend in property values.
Updated: June 2026
